VueJS Импортировать только используемые стили из bootstrap - PullRequest
0 голосов
/ 28 мая 2020

Я использую npm bootstrap и импортирую только классы, которые я использовал для своего проекта в custom.s css

@import '~bootstrap/scss/functions.scss';
@import '~bootstrap/scss/variables.scss';
@import "~bootstrap/scss/mixins";
@import '~bootstrap/scss/transitions.scss';
@import '~bootstrap/scss/nav.scss';
@import '~bootstrap/scss/navbar.scss';
@import '~bootstrap/scss/buttons.scss';
@import '~bootstrap/scss/forms.scss';
@import '~bootstrap/scss/images.scss';
@import '~bootstrap/scss/bootstrap-grid.scss';
@import '~bootstrap/scss/type.scss';
@import '~bootstrap/scss/media.scss';
@import "~bootstrap/scss/dropdown.scss";
@import "~bootstrap/scss/reboot.scss";

@import "~bootstrap/scss/utilities/spacing.scss";
@import "~bootstrap/scss/utilities/text.scss";
@import "~bootstrap/scss/utilities/background.scss";
@import "~bootstrap/scss/utilities/position.scss";
@import "~bootstrap/scss/utilities/sizing.scss";
@import "~bootstrap/scss/utilities/spacing.scss";
@import "~bootstrap/scss/utilities/borders.scss";
@import "~bootstrap/scss/utilities/float.scss";

@import "~bootstrap/scss/mixins/transition.scss";

, однако коллапс панели навигации больше не работает. какой недостающий файл мне нужно импортировать? любая помощь будет оценена

Изменить: добавлены все bootstrap и все еще не работает

@import '~bootstrap/scss/bootstrap.scss';

1 Ответ

0 голосов
/ 28 мая 2020
Папка

отредактирована

Bootstrap JS находится в таком каталоге. Вы будете использовать оператор @import, чтобы использовать его в своем файле s css.

bootstrap/
└── dist/
    ├── scss/
    └── js/
        ├── bootstrap.bundle.js
        ├── bootstrap.bundle.js.map
        ├── bootstrap.bundle.min.js
        ├── bootstrap.bundle.min.js.map
        ├── bootstrap.js
        ├── bootstrap.js.map
        ├── bootstrap.min.js
        └── bootstrap.min.js.map

Кроме того, убедитесь, что вы установили jQuery и Popper, поскольку это взаимозависимости.

npm install --save jquery popper.js.
...